Ryzen 9 9950X3D

The Ryzen 9 9950X3D is manufactured by AMD. It was released in 6 January 2025 (less than a year ago). It is based on the Granite Ridge (2024−2025) architecture. It features 16 cores and 32 threads. Base frequency is 4.3 GHz, with boost up to 5.7 GHz. L3 cache: 128 MB (total). L2 cache: 1 MB (per core). Built on 4 nm process technology. Socket: AM5. Thermal design power (TDP): 170 Watt. Memory support: DDR5. Passmark benchmark score: 70,177 points. Launch price was $699.

Intel

Xeon 6730P

The Xeon 6730P is manufactured by Intel. It was released in 24 February 2025 (less than a year ago). It is based on the Granite Rapids (2024−2025) architecture. It features 32 cores and 64 threads. Base frequency is 2.5 GHz, with boost up to 3.8 GHz. L3 cache: 288 MB (total). L2 cache: 2 MB (per core). Built on Intel 3 nm process technology. Socket: LGA4710. Thermal design power (TDP): 250 Watt. Memory support: DDR5(6400MT/s). Passmark benchmark score: 74,113 points. Launch price was $3,726.

Processing Power

The Ryzen 9 9950X3D packs 16 cores / 32 threads, while the Xeon 6730P offers 32 cores / 64 threads — the Xeon 6730P has 16 more cores. Boost clocks reach 5.7 GHz on the Ryzen 9 9950X3D versus 3.8 GHz on the Xeon 6730P — a 40% clock advantage for the Ryzen 9 9950X3D (base: 4.3 GHz vs 2.5 GHz). The Ryzen 9 9950X3D uses the Granite Ridge (2024−2025) architecture (4 nm), while the Xeon 6730P uses Granite Rapids (2024−2025) (Intel 3 nm). In PassMark, the Ryzen 9 9950X3D scores 70,177 against the Xeon 6730P's 74,113 — a 5.5% lead for the Xeon 6730P. L3 cache: 128 MB (total) on the Ryzen 9 9950X3D vs 288 MB (total) on the Xeon 6730P.

Memory & Platform

The Ryzen 9 9950X3D uses the AM5 socket (PCIe 5.0), while the Xeon 6730P uses LGA4710 (PCIe 4.0) — making them incompatible on the same motherboard. Maximum memory speed reaches DDR5-5600 on the Ryzen 9 9950X3D versus 6400 on the Xeon 6730P — the Xeon 6730P supports 199.7% faster memory, which can translate to measurable gains in memory-sensitive workloads. The Xeon 6730P supports up to 4096 of RAM compared to 192 GB 182.1% more capacity for professional workloads. Memory channels: 2 (Ryzen 9 9950X3D) vs 8 (Xeon 6730P). PCIe lanes: 24 (Ryzen 9 9950X3D) vs 80 (Xeon 6730P) — the Xeon 6730P offers 56 more lanes for additional GPUs or NVMe drives. Chipset compatibility: X670E,X670,B650E,B650 (Ryzen 9 9950X3D) and C741 (Xeon 6730P).

Advanced Features

Only the Ryzen 9 9950X3D has an unlocked multiplier for overclocking — a significant advantage for enthusiasts seeking extra performance. Both support AVX-512 instructions, benefiting scientific computing, AI inference, and encryption workloads. Virtualization support: true (Ryzen 9 9950X3D) vs VT-x, VT-d, TDX (Xeon 6730P). The Ryzen 9 9950X3D includes integrated graphics (Radeon Graphics (2 Cores)), while the Xeon 6730P requires a dedicated GPU. Direct competitor: Ryzen 9 9950X3D rivals Core Ultra 9 285K; Xeon 6730P rivals EPYC 9354.
